They do have some tvs at Tegal Sari and will lend them to you and install in your room, if requested. Not sure about dvd players, but knowing the way they handle all other guest requests, most likely will offer dvd too.

We had a tv in the room at Ubud Village Hotel.
Staff were ok and breakfast ok too (I didnt say great about either).

We have stayed at Tegal Sari on most trips to Ubud, and love it.
Last trip, as we couldnt get into Tegal Sari (You have book early and pay up front with your booking, only 24 rooms) we stayed at Ubud Village Hotel. Although we liked the hotel, location etc we felt terribly closed in. One morning I went out in the front private courtyard and felt clastrophobic and not feeling like I was in Bali. There was nothing to see within the high walls, unlike Tegal Sari, where your patio/balcony is private yet you can watch Bali at work. There is always something to see on the rice paddies, sowers, weeders, reapers, thrashers, bird scarer-offerers, ducks and duck farmers, egg collectors and you can hear the continual gentle noises of everyday life. The ducks quack, the women chatter, frogs croak and the birds tweet!

There is also Vila Rasa Sayang in the Monkey Forest road area, close to restaurants, shops etc. Not sure that they have tv, but rooms were very large and cost us au$50 per night, with breakfast included.
